    The Cellular Mechanisms of Brain-Body Interactions Workshop will focus on the critical interaction of the nervous system with myriad cell types in physiological systems across the body. Coordination of homeostatic processes in animals requires communication between the body and the brain, and our goal in this meeting is to identify the most pressing questions and exciting directions pertaining to the mechanisms of bidirectional communication between neurons and other cell types and physiological systems throughout the body.
